But the side effects aren’t that big, no?

More common
  1. Fast or irregular heartbeat
  2. Bloating
  3. flushing or redness of skin
  4. swelling of feet or lower legs
Less common
  1. Chest pain
  2. shortness of breath
  3. Numbness or tingling of hands, feet, or face
Note: there are ways to drastically Minimize side effects, just do some research
